QuantumPips RSI Pro, Strip Overlay is a momentum visualization tool that places a compact RSI strip directly on the price chart, so you can read overbought/oversold pressure without using a separate lower pane.
This indicator is designed to help traders answer three practical questions in real time:
Is momentum stretched (OB/OS)?
Has momentum reset back inside a level (Reclaim)?
Is the current move supported by volume and trend bias (Panel)?
What you will see
1) RSI Strip on the chart
A mini RSI band is plotted near the bottom of your chart:
Red zone = overbought region
Green zone = oversold region
RSI is highlighted more strongly when it is actually inside those zones.
2) Reclaim markers (main chart)
The indicator prints Reclaim↑ and Reclaim↓ labels on your candles:
Reclaim↑ (bullish reclaim): RSI dipped into oversold and then reclaimed back above the oversold level.
Reclaim↓ (bearish reclaim): RSI pushed into overbought and then reclaimed back below the overbought level.
These are not “guaranteed entries.” They are momentum reset events that can be used as confirmation alongside your own structure, support/resistance, or session strategy.
3) Side panel (quick decision dashboard)
The top-right panel summarizes the current state:
Overbought (Yes/No)
Oversold (Yes/No)
Reclaim: Up / Down / None
Volume: High / Normal (based on volume vs its moving average)
Trend Bias: Bull / Bear / Flat (EMA-based, optional)
The goal is to reduce hesitation and make the “market condition” easy to read quickly.
How to use it
A simple workflow:
Look at the strip
If RSI is deep in green, price may be stretched down (watch for recovery).
If RSI is deep in red, price may be stretched up (watch for cooling).
Wait for a reclaim
Reclaim↑ suggests momentum is recovering from oversold.
Reclaim↓ suggests momentum is cooling from overbought.
Use the panel for confluence
If reclaim aligns with Trend Bias and Volume, it often becomes a cleaner setup environment.
If reclaim fights the trend bias, treat it more cautiously.
Recommended markets / timeframes
Works well for intraday momentum reading on instruments like Gold (XAUUSD) and Nasdaq, especially on 5m–15m charts.
Higher timeframes can be used for smoother signals, while lower timeframes will react faster but produce more noise.

RVol %█ OVERVIEW
RVol % measures today's volume as a percentage of the 30-day average volume, displayed directly on your chart. It helps you instantly gauge whether current trading activity is unusually high, normal, or quiet - a critical piece of context for validating breakouts, spotting institutional activity, and filtering out low-conviction moves.
█ WHY RELATIVE VOLUME MATTERS
Raw volume numbers are hard to interpret on their own. 5 million shares on AAPL is a slow day; on a small cap, it's enormous. Relative Volume (RVol) solves this by expressing today's volume as a percentage of its recent average, giving you a normalized, comparable metric across any instrument.
🔴 RVol > 150% - Unusually high activity. Something is driving interest: earnings, news, institutional positioning. Price moves on high RVol tend to be more reliable.
🟠 RVol 100–150% - Normal to slightly elevated. Confirms steady participation.
⚪ RVol < 100% - Below-average interest. Breakouts on low RVol are more likely to fail. Ranges may persist.
█ FEATURES
⬜ Multi-Timeframe Accuracy
The indicator always calculates volume from the daily timeframe, regardless of your chart resolution. Whether you're on a 1-minute or weekly chart, the RVol reading reflects the true daily figure compared to the 30-day daily average.
⬜ Session Filtering
Toggle "Regular Session Only" to exclude pre-market and after-hours volume from the calculation. This gives you a cleaner read on participation during the main trading session.
⬜ On-Chart Labels (fully customizable, can be toggled on/off)
Configurable labels appear at the first bar of each session showing the RVol percentage. You can control visibility, history depth (last N days), size, position (above/below bars), background color, and vertical offset.
⬜ Volume Heatmap Background
An optional color-shaded background highlights the volume regime across the chart. Transparency is adjustable so it doesn't interfere with your price action analysis.
⬜ VWAP on High-Volume Days
When RVol exceeds a configurable threshold (default: 150%), the indicator automatically plots an intraday VWAP line. VWAP is a key reference for institutional traders - showing it only on high-volume days keeps your chart clean while highlighting the sessions where it matters most.
⬜ Alert System
Built-in alert conditions let you get notified without watching the chart:
🔔 RVol Extreme - Fires when volume exceeds the high threshold (default: 200%)
🔔 RVol Elevated - Fires when volume exceeds the mid threshold (default: 150%)
🔔 Low Previous Day - Flags sessions following a below-average volume day
Set these up through TradingView's standard Alerts menu to receive push, email, or webhook notifications.
⬜ Info Panel
A compact table in the top-right corner displays the current RVol %, today's raw volume, the 30-day average volume, and the active session mode (Regular / Full).

█ HOW TO USE
Breakout confirmation: When price breaks a key level, check the RVol label. Above 150% adds conviction; below 80% is a warning sign.
Spotting unusual activity : A sudden spike to 200%+ with no obvious news can signal institutional accumulation or distribution before a move.
Intraday monitoring: The label updates in real time throughout the session. If RVol is building fast early in the day, it often signals a trending session ahead.
VWAP as a magnet: On high-volume days, price tends to revert toward VWAP. Use the auto-plotted VWAP as a reference for mean-reversion entries or as dynamic support/resistance.
█ NOTES
On intraday timeframes, the daily volume accumulates throughout the session, so the RVol percentage will naturally rise as the day progresses. The final value is only confirmed at session close.
The 30-day average uses a simple moving average (SMA) of daily volume. You can adjust the lookback period in settings.

Dynamic Previous Period Highs and Lows + Sessions + MacrosInstitutional Liquidity & Multi-Timeframe Open Levels
This comprehensive institutional trading tool is designed for day traders who rely on high-probability liquidity levels and key institutional opening prices. It automates the tracking of previous period highs and lows across multiple timeframes while providing precise visualization of New York session opens and critical trading macros.
Key Features
1. Dynamic HTF Liquidity Levels
The indicator automatically plots the High and Low of the previous period for the following timeframes:
15-Minute (15M)
1-Hour (1H)
4-Hour (4H)
Daily (D)
These levels serve as primary targets for liquidity runs (Buy-side/Sell-side liquidity) and are essential for identifying "Previous Day High/Low" (PDH/PDL) setups.
2. Institutional Opening Prices
Opening prices act as magnets and "fair price" anchors. This script tracks the most significant New York opens:
NY Midnight Open: The true start of the institutional day.
8:30 AM Open: Often associated with high-impact news releases and the start of the pre-market volatility.
9:30 AM Open: The equities market open (NYSE), frequently a catalyst for the day's trend or a "Judas Swing."
Note: These lines automatically clean up at 18:00 (6:00 PM) NY time to prepare your chart for the next trading day.
3. Session & Macro Tracking
The indicator includes deep integration for session-based trading:
Sessions & Killzones: Visualizes Asia, London, NY AM, and NY PM sessions with integrated library support for "Kill Zone" detection.
NY Macros: Highlights critical macro windows (02:00-03:00, 10:00-11:00, and 15:00-16:00 NY Time) where algorithmic activity typically spikes.
4. Clean & Intelligent Visuals
Text-Only Labels: To avoid chart clutter, labels are rendered as text-only (transparent backgrounds), color-matched to their respective lines.
Timeframe Filters: Higher-frequency levels (like 15M and 1H) are automatically hidden on higher timeframes to keep your analysis focused and professional.
How to Use
Liquidity Purge: Look for price to sweep the Previous Period High or Low before seeking a reversal.
Premium/Discount: Use the Daily Open and NY Opens to determine if you are buying in a discount (below open) or selling in a premium (above open).
Session Confluence: Look for setups that occur within the highlighted Macro windows or during the start of the NY AM/PM sessions.

EMA Trend System with ORB, VWAP & Bias Score - by TenAMTraderEMA Trend System with ORB, VWAP & Bias Score
The EMA Trend System with ORB, VWAP & Bias Score is a streamlined intraday trading tool designed to help traders quickly understand trend direction, market bias, and opening range structure.
This indicator combines EMA trend structure, VWAP positioning, Opening Range levels, daily moving averages, a dynamic EMA cloud, and a weighted bias engine into one clean visual system. A compact on-chart table summarizes key market conditions so traders can quickly determine whether the environment favors long trades, short trades, or caution.
The goal is simple: help traders stay aligned with the dominant trend instead of reacting late to price movement.
Core Features:
EMA Trend Structure
The indicator tracks the relationship between the 3, 8, 21, and 200 EMAs to identify trend alignment.
Features include:
• 8 / 21 EMA Cloud for visual trend bias
• EMA stacking logic for bullish or bearish structure
• Optional 3/21 EMA cross signals for momentum shifts
• Optional 3 EMA visibility toggle
This provides a fast visual read on trend strength and structure.
Trend Background Visualization
Optional background coloring helps traders quickly recognize market bias.
Two modes are available:
• Fast Bias Mode – reflects bullish or bearish EMA positioning
• Strict Trend Mode – highlights confirmed trend alignment
This allows traders to quickly see whether market conditions favor bullish momentum, bearish momentum, or neutral structure.
Opening Range System
The Opening Range module helps frame early session price structure.
Levels plotted:
• ORBH – Opening Range High
• ORBM – Opening Range Midpoint
• ORBL – Opening Range Low
Options include:
• Adjustable Opening Range duration
• Optional Opening Range box visualization
• Optional ORB labels placed directly on the levels
• Optional signal filtering based on ORB breakouts
These levels help identify breakout zones and key intraday support/resistance.
Smart Trade Signals
The indicator includes reclaim-style signals designed for trend continuation setups.
Signals occur when price:
• Reclaims the fast EMA
• Aligns with EMA trend structure
• Meets optional Opening Range conditions
Optional Re-Entry signals appear when price pulls back to the 8 EMA while holding the 21 EMA, allowing traders to participate in continuation moves without chasing price.
Bias Score (1–10)
A built-in Bias Score summarizes overall market sentiment using multiple structural factors:
• Position relative to 200 EMA
• Position relative to VWAP
• Position relative to 20-day SMA
• Position relative to 50-day SMA
• EMA structure alignment
• Opening Range behavior
• Current candle direction
Score interpretation:
1–3 → Bearish
4–6 → Neutral
7–10 → Bullish
This provides a quick numerical gauge of overall market conditions.
Trend Summary Table
A compact table displayed on the chart provides an instant overview of market structure.
The table displays:
• Trend Direction
• Trend Strength
• 21 EMA Bias
• 200 EMA Position
• Bias Score
This allows traders to quickly evaluate the market environment without scanning multiple indicators.
Best Use Cases
This indicator works well for:
• Index futures trading (NQ, MNQ, ES)
• Intraday momentum trading
• Opening Range breakout strategies
• EMA trend structure trading
• VWAP-based trading
It can also be applied to stocks and ETFs where trend structure and VWAP behavior are important.
Tip
Many traders focus on long setups when the Bias Score is 7 or higher and short setups when the Bias Score is 3 or lower, while price remains aligned with the EMA cloud.
